000034133 - Unable to start RSA Adaptive Authentication (on Premise) 7.1 P6 on weblogic 12.1.3

Document created by RSA Customer Support Employee on Oct 11, 2016Last modified by RSA Customer Support Employee on Apr 22, 2017
Version 2Show Document
  • View in full screen mode

Article Content

Article Number000034133
Applies ToRSA Product Set: Adaptive Authentication (OnPrem)
RSA Product/Service Type: Adaptive Authentication (OnPrem)
RSA Version/Condition: 7.1 P6
Platform: Linux
 
IssueUnable to deploy Adaptive Authentication 7.1 P6 on Weblogic Server 12.1.3 as the following error was seen in weblogic server log
 
####<Sep 26, 2016 12:10:11 PM COT> <Error> <HTTP> <mdrasqa01> <Motor_Server_1> <[STANDBY] 
ExecuteThread: '1' for queue: 'weblogic.kernel.Default (self-tuning)'>
<<WLS Kernel>> <> <> <1474909811616>
<BEA-101216> <Servlet: "AxisServlet" failed to preload on startup in Web application: "AdaptiveAuthentication".
org.apache.axis2.AxisFault: The system is attempting to engage a module that is not available: addressing
                at org.apache.axis2.engine.AxisConfiguration.engageModule(AxisConfiguration.java:584)
                at org.apache.axis2.engine.AxisConfiguration.engageGlobalModules(AxisConfiguration.java:705)
                at org.apache.axis2.deployment.DeploymentEngine.engageModules(DeploymentEngine.java:831)
                at org.apache.axis2.deployment.WarBasedAxisConfigurator.engageGlobalModules(WarBasedAxisConfigurator.java:300)
                at org.apache.axis2.context.ConfigurationContextFactory.
createConfigurationContext(ConfigurationContextFactory.java:94)
                at org.apache.axis2.transport.http.AxisServlet.initConfigContext(AxisServlet.java:584)
                at org.apache.axis2.transport.http.AxisServlet.init(AxisServlet.java:454)
                at weblogic.servlet.internal.StubSecurityHelper$ServletInitAction.run(StubSecurityHelper.java:337)
                at weblogic.servlet.internal.StubSecurityHelper$ServletInitAction.run(StubSecurityHelper.java:288)
                at webl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Subject.java:321)


 
ResolutionThe file to be modified is axis2.xml under <AdaptiveAuthentication>/WEB-INF/conf directory.
The value to comment out is the reference to the module : <module ref="addressing"/>
Once you have done that, do a restart and the application comes up without any issues

Attachments

    Outcomes